The Combo Relay & Opto Board is a handy accessory that allows much higher voltages and currents controlled via 4 Relay Outputs and four optically isolated input channels by the Tempero I/O  modules.

Relay board with opto-isolated input has been designed to a 72mm standard width so that it can easily be mounted in the DIN rail  mounting module;

BOARD FEATURES:
  • 4 x 12V DPDT 250VAC / 30DC @ 5A Relays
  • 4 x Optically Isolated Inputs for each of the I/O24 port pins
  • Indication LED’s for output status and channel input
  • Screw Terminal Blocks for relay outputs, input channels and 12V Power Input
  • Easy connection by 10-way box header to suit standard IDC connector for connection to the I/O port.
  • 72mm Standard width for DIN
Relays: Panasonic JW series
  • JW2SN-DC12V
  • Contact Rating 5 A @ 250 VAC 5A @ 30 VDC
  • Max. Allowable Power Force 1250 VA/150 W
  • Max. Allowable Voltage 240 V AC/110 V DC
  • Max. Carrying Current 5 A (AC), 5 A (DC) (standard)
  • Relay Form ‐ Form C, Double‐Pole Double‐Throw (DPDT)
  • Output Terminals Normally Open (NO), Common (COM) Normally
  • Closed (NC)
  • Relay Life (mech.) 10 million operations minimum
  • Relay Life (load dependent) 100 thousand operations minimum
  • Operating Time 15 mSec. Max.
  • Release Time 8 mSec max
  • Coil Nominal Operating 44mA +/‐ 10% 20C
  • Coil Resistance 270 ohm +/‐ 10% 20C
Opto Isolated Input Electrical Characteristics:
  • Logical Input High Voltage 3 to 24V AC or DC
  • Logical Input High Current 1mA to 12mA
  • Optically isolated to 7500 VAC (peak)
Environment:
  • Operating temperature ‐30° to 55° C
  • Storage Temperature ‐20° to 70° C
  • Operating Humidity 45% to 85% RH
